I got a question on Matlab. I am trying to build Array of min values from Two dimensional Array. Basically, the idea is to look for minimum value at each column & record the index.
If there are more then one minimum value then record it in different array, but the new array upto that point should be similar to previous one.
Its like finding minimum values link from mxn array.
Can you please help me to efficiently code this?

[junk, index] = min(your_matrix); %will get you the first index
To get all minimum indices:
A = magic(4); %sample
A(7) = 2; %set duplicate for example
[r c] = find(bsxfun(@eq,min(A),A)); %all column mins
colmindex = accumarray(c,r,[],@(x){x})' %bin them into a row vector cell array with each index
Hi Sean, Thanks for reply. This gives me the first Minimum at each column.
I am hoping to build multiple level of index. If say one column contains more than 1 minimum then I would like to create multiple single index array.
Say A =
0 0 1 2 3 4
2 3 1 3 4 1
1 1 2 0 3 7
>> [junk, index] = min(A)
junk =
0 0 1 0 3 1
index =
1 1 1 3 1 2
Gives only the first minimum index but if you look at the matrix. I am hoping to get the following
index1 = 1 1 1 3 1 2 index2 = 1 1 2 3 1 2 index3 = 1 1 1 3 3 2 index4 = 1 1 2 3 3 2
same for junk variable.
